  • Publication number: 20180047950
    Abstract: Provided is a sealing apparatus of a pouch-type secondary battery, capable of preventing electrolyte leakage by constantly positioning a lead on a sealing groove so as to completely seal the secondary battery. A sealing apparatus according to the present disclosure is a sealing apparatus of a pouch-type secondary battery which seals a pouch case in which an electrode assembly is installed. The sealing apparatus includes upper and lower sealing blocks, wherein at least one sealing block of the upper and lower sealing blocks has a sealing groove having a slanted step portion which is formed at a position corresponding to the lead of the pouch-type secondary battery and a lead guide for seating the lead on the sealing groove is installed in front of the sealing block.

  • Patent number: 9653724
    Abstract: A secondary battery according to the present disclosure includes a cell assembly including a unit cell having at least one non-coated passage formed across an electrode plate, a temperature sensor including a temperature sensing unit located within the non-coated passage and a sensor lead extending from the temperature sensing unit, and a battery case to receive the cell assembly and which is sealed in a state that the sensor lead is drawn outside. According to the present disclosure, a temperature change of the secondary battery may be measured quickly and correctly, and thus, the secondary battery may be controlled more minutely in response to a temperature change, and gas generated in the battery case during charging and discharging of the secondary battery may be easily discharged to a surrounding area of the cell assembly, thereby preventing a battery efficiency reduction phenomenon.

  • Publication number: 20160043840
    Abstract: A packet transmitter includes a higher layer transmission block and a lower layer transmission block. The higher layer transmission block generates a higher layer data signal including payload data and a header for each packet of a plurality of packets based on an application layer data signal and an application layer control signal. The higher layer transmission block outputs the header after the payload data through the higher layer data signal. The lower layer transmission block generates a lower layer data signal including the header and the payload data for each packet based on the higher layer data signal and a higher layer control signal. The lower layer transmission block outputs the payload data after the header through the lower layer data signal.

  • Patent number: 9157621
    Abstract: A device for fixing a warning lamp of a construction machine according to the present invention is disposed on a side of a frame of an operating compartment, and includes an upper sleeve, a fixing bracket, a lower sleeve, a supporting lever, an upper elastic member, and a lower elastic member. The supporting lever spaces the upper sleeve apart from the lower sleeve by a certain distance, and rotatably supports the upper sleeve and the lower sleeve. The upper elastic member and the lower elastic member are coupled to both side ends of the supporting lever to elastically support the upper sleeve and the lower sleeve respectively, and are coupled in a multi-joint structure. When the construction machine is on a construction site in wet weather, or is kept on a certain site, the warning lamp can be adjusted to various postures.
